				Sega announced today that they will be re-releasing games from the Dreamcast library on XBLA/PSN starting this fall. The first 2 titles will be Sonic Adventure and Crazy Taxi, and then more will follow. The ports will feature higher resolution graphics, surround sound support, online leaderboards, achievements, etc. Pretty awesome news I think.

				Genesis games don't need to be licensed by Sega though. They need to be licensed by the original company. Nintendo might also pay a general fee to Sega to emulate the Genesis, but Sega doesn't make money directly off any Genesis games they don't own the publishing rights to. Since this article is about Sega announcing "enhanced DC ports" and not DC emulation, one must assume they are Sega games. Sega has no interest or concern in whether or not other companies are releasing enhanced DC ports.
